The UK’s response to Ukraine’s refugee crisis

With Dawn-Maria France, Duncan Weldon & John Inverdale

A ROUND-UP AND REVIEW OF THE WEEK’S BIGGEST NEWS STORIES


In this week’s ‘News Roundtable’ episode, host Chris Wright is joined by Dawn-Maria France, editor-in-chief at Yorkshire Women’s Life; Duncan Weldon, an economist and writer; and John Inverdale, a broadcaster who presented coverage of many major sporting events including the Olympic Games and Wimbledon.

The episode begins by analysing the UK’s response to the humanitarian crisis in Ukraine, to discuss whether the Home Office is failing Ukrainian refugees with the lack of forward planning, and the impact of a Nationality and Borders Bill on Ukrainians who are making their way into the UK.

The conversation moves on to discuss whether the UK government has shown true leadership, and the British public’s perception of the handling of the crisis, with polling showing huge support for the UK to grant visas to Ukrainian refugees.

Together they also discuss the impact of sanctions on Russian oligarchs, and Roman Abramovich: What do the Russian owner’s sanctions mean for Chelsea Football Club?
